How to Convert 103 Kilopascals to Standard Atmospheres
To convert, start with the base conversion factor:
1 Kilopascal = 0.0098692327 Standard Atmospheres
Now, we can multiply both sides by 103 to find the result for your value:
(1 × 103) kPa = (0.0098692327 × 103) atm
103 kPa = 1.016531 atm

Conversion Factors
1 Kilopascal = 0.0098692327 Standard Atmospheres
1 Standard Atmosphere = 101.325 Kilopascals
Formula:
Standard Atmospheres = Kilopascals × 0.0098692327
Calculation:
103 kPa × 0.0098692327 = 1.016531 atm
